The Production Runner role at AEG offers an exciting opportunity to be an integral part of this dynamic environment. This position is pivotal in ensuring that event logistics and production needs are executed efficiently and safely. Responsible for handling and transporting vital event materials, the Production Runner acts as a vital link between the production team and event venues. This role requires adaptability, organizational skills, and a hands-on approach to support seamless event execution.
In this capacity, the Production Runner manages a variety of tasks, from collecting and delivering equipment and supplies to running errands using various modes of transportation including on foot, by bike, vehicle, or public transit. The position also involves assisting the production office with administrative responsibilities such as creating signage, drafting correspondence, and maintaining inventory records. In essence, the Production Runner is the go-to person who ensures that production and artist requests are fulfilled promptly, contributing to the overall success of each event.

Job Duties
- collect, transport, and deliver equipment, supplies, and materials to and from the venue
- run various errands by foot, bike, vehicle, or public transportation at various distances
- make purchases for the show and venue as needed for event needs as directed by the production manager or supervisor
- assist the production office with administrative duties including making signage, drafting correspondence, and taking inventory
- perform other various duties as required or requested from supervisor to fulfill show needs and artist rider
